cupure logo

Leader of the Catholic Church in England and Wales rules himself OUT of becoming next Pope

Leader of the Catholic Church in England and Wales rules himself OUT of becoming next Pope
The leader of the Catholic Church in England and Wales has ruled himself out of running as the next Pope, MailOnline can reveal.

Comments

Similar News

Breaking news